Is it just me or did this last months meeting work out really well. My only reason for wanting to do lightning round talks was to mitigate having 3 1-hour talks dominate the entire meeting; as the meetings are supposed to be social first. We had 3-ish talks that lasted about an hour total (from AltF4, Candis, and I). What worked out is that in that given hour, sticking to a 10-15 minute format didn't really matter (being that we kept the entire round to under an hour). The talk by Candis was over 15 minutes (and as it should have been given the content), and mine may have been under 5 minutes (probably about 10), and Alts was somewhere in the sweet spot.


As much as I dislike too much formality, maybe we should strive to replicate this cap. One suggestion would be for those who want to give a talk to submit to this discussion group (under whatever monthly topic like “October 2014 Meeting”). Pretty much just what you plan to talk about and how long you think it should take. That way we know how many is too many for that month.
